About This Property

This detached house is located in Warrington, WA4 4EU. The property offers 378m² (4069 sq ft) of generously-sized living space. The property holds an EPC rating of C (74/100), meeting the government's target standard for energy efficiency. Heating is provided by oil-fired central heating. While effective, oil prices can be volatile and the system produces higher carbon emissions than gas or heat pumps. Estimated annual energy costs are £2433, comprising £1933 for heating, £196 for hot water, and £304 for lighting. The property produces 9.1 tonnes of CO2 per year, which is high for a UK home.

About school ratings: Ofsted ratings range from Outstanding to Inadequate. These ratings are based on inspections of teaching quality, leadership, pupil behavior, and safety. Note that school catchment areas vary - check with the school or local council for admission details.

What do these speeds mean? 10-30 Mbps: Good for browsing and streaming. 30-100 Mbps: Great for multiple users and HD streaming. 100-300 Mbps: Excellent for 4K streaming and gaming. 300+ Mbps: Perfect for large households and heavy internet use.
